INDIANAPOLIS — The Indianapolis Fire Department is accepting applications to join their team now through May 7.
They are searching for applicants that meet the following criteria:
- Must be between the ages of 21-36 on date of hire OR younger than 40 years and six months if 20 years of military service have been completed
- Must have a high school diploma of GED
- Must have no felony convictions that have not been expunged by a court
- Must have a valid driver's license
- Must be a citizen of the United States or be legally able to work in the United States
- Must be willing to reside in Marion County or a contiguous county
Firefighters with the IFD benefit from the salary of $54,215 in the first year and employment and $63,715 in the second year of employment. This comes with life, dental, and medical insurance among other benefits.
